Overview of the Renault Kadjar
Are you in the market for a medium-sized SUV/crossover that offers style, practicality, and good equipment levels? Look no further than the Renault Kadjar. Launched in 2015 and updated in late 2018, the Kadjar received positive reviews from UK media sources for its design, practicality, and affordability compared to its rivals.
Although the Kadjar shares a platform with the Nissan Qashqai, it is considered to be more stylishly designed. It offers good reliability, low running costs, and competitive CO2 emissions. However, its safety rating has expired, so it’s essential to keep that in mind when considering a used Kadjar.
If you’re interested in purchasing a used Renault Kadjar, it’s worth noting that it has a Used Car Expert Rating of B, with a score of 68%. The car has received praise for its reliability record, but it’s essential to be aware of potential repair costs, especially for engine repairs.
In terms of running costs, the Renault Kadjar is relatively affordable to own and run. Servicing costs are reasonable for the first five years, and insurance premiums should also be competitive. Fuel economy is good for diesel models and average for petrol models.
